I have a CROSSHAIR X670E HERO paired with a Strix 4090 and an AMD 7950X.
Currently, I have 3 LG OLED TVs connected using HDMI-to-HDMI cables.
Since the GPU only has 2 HDMI outputs, and I couldn’t find a DP-to-HDMI adapter capable of handling 4K 144Hz HDR with 10/12-bit RGB, I decided to connect the third HDMI cable to the motherboard's HDMI port. To my surprise, it works flawlessly: stable 4K at 144Hz with HDR 10-bit RGB.
Its alle good, but HOW on earth is this even working?
The CPU doesn’t have an iGPU, so the motherboard's HDMI port shouldn’t work at all.
Does the MB come with an HDMI passthrough? I Couldnt find further information.
How is this not only working but performing like a pro?
Im worried this is just a glitch in the matrix and some futur firmware update might ruin it for me.
